Transaction c3bdaabac38d543728f6c46066de5d43acb2d18cd9ea44d57d8251c5a8559861
1 Input
1 Output
-
c3bdaabac38d543728f6c46066de5d43acb2d18cd9ea44d57d8251c5a8559861:0
- value
- 23689011
- script pubkey
- OP_0 OP_PUSHBYTES_20 d45b451015bd5dc1046204dd2034f78b4e348155
- address
- bc1q63d52yq4h4wuzprzqnwjqd8h3d8rfq24nkvqr9